Recently passed general class after having let my old advanced
class license (KA1UL) lapse quite a few years aso. I have a couple of
partially restored boatanchors in the basement but am looking into
getting a more modern HF transciever...probably used, only a few years
old. So many manufacturers and moidels on the market these days...

What rigs would you guys look for with this list of features.


You forgot how much money do you want to spend ? With the Icom 706 selling
new for under $ 800 you can get a lot of rig for that price.
